Pracuj.pl will debut on the Polish stock exchange on December 9, 2021. The public offering will cover 22.380.626 existing shares, representing 32,86 percent. share capital, and the maximum price has been set at PLN 82 per share. What do we need to know before we decide to buy shares in this company?

Virtually every person who is looking for an office job in Poland via the Internet has used the website pracuj.pl. Grupa Pracuj is one of the largest job and employee search platforms in Central and Eastern Europe. The company also offers software sold in the form of SaaS, which is to support the recruitment process in companies (eRecruiter). The main markets for the company are Poland and Ukraine. Company history

The beginnings of Grupa Pracuj date back to 2000, when the company Commuication Partners was established. It was then that the first version of the Pracuj.pl website was created. In March 2001, the eKatalyst fund invested in the company. The beginnings of the company were very difficult, the clients were several dozen of the largest companies in Poland that were open to looking for employees via the Internet. The company took advantage of the difficult macro-economic environment (the bursting dotcom banks) for acquisitions. In April 2002 she took over Jobaid.pl. Since 2003, more and more companies have been convinced to take advantage of online job posting. Along with the increase in market adaptation, there was a sharp increase in the scale of operations. In November 2003, the company was recognized as one of the fastest growing IT companies in Central and Eastern Europe, according to Deloitte's FAST50 ranking. 

The dynamic development of the company has also been noticed by large funds. In 2006, Tiger Global appeared among the shareholders, specializing in looking for prospective companies around the world. During this year, the company started its foreign expansion. Robota International, the owner of the Ukrainian recruitment website, Robota.ua, was acquired. In 2008, the company already had 700 unique users and 000 job offers. The flywheel effect began to work. The more job offers there were, the more job seekers appeared. As the number of users grew, it became easier for companies to find a new employee. In 2014, the website pracuj.pl was used by 3 million unique users and 22 job offers were active. 

Two years later (2016), the company's revenues exceeded PLN 200 million. In the same year, Grupa Pracuj purchased shares from Tiger Global. A year later, the TCV investment fund invested in Pracuj. It is worth mentioning that  the fund invested in companies such as Facebook, Netflix or Spotify. The TCV fund invested in a Polish company for the first time. In 2019, Grupa Pracuj made an attempt to diversify its activities. As a result, the Pracuj Ventures fund was established, which focuses on investing in start-ups that deal with technologies that contribute to increasing the effectiveness of HR and the education process. Currently, the company has developed two of these concepts - theprotocol.it and Dtyg.pl.

IPO offer

According to the information contained in the prospectus, the existing shareholders intend to sell 20% of the company's shares. If there are more potential buyers, it will be possible to increase the number of shares offered to 32,86% of the company. The value of the offer will range from PLN 1,1 billion to PLN 1,8 billion. The TCV fund, which so far owned 26,66% of Grupa Pracuj shares, will be selling the most shares. Part of the offer includes blocks of shares belonging to the co-founders of the company. However, after the offer, Przemysław Gacek (the president of the Group) will still hold no less than 53% of shares in Grupa Pracuj.

Operating activity of Grupa Pracuj.pl

Pracuj.pl is a leading technology platform operating on the recruitment market. The recruiting platform helps in two ways. 

First, the company's solutions are to make it easier for HR departments of companies to find new employees who meet the requirements of employers. Thanks to the use of the Pracuj offer, enterprises can quickly publish and update job offers, providing users (potential employees) with relevant information regarding the position, scope of duties or earnings. 

Secondly, the websites pracuj.pl and robota.ua are aimed at offering users an easy way to change jobs. Users can easily find interesting job offers. Both these  companies related to the industry (e.g. IT, finance), way of working (remotely, stationary) or workplace (e.g. Warsaw, Gdańsk, Kraków, etc.). Additionally, Pracuj.pl users can receive personalized notifications on their e-mail regarding potential interesting job offers.

The main source of revenues (86,6%) of Grupa Pracuj are fees for placing a job offer by employers or recruitment agencies. This revenue group also includes additional services related to job offers (the so-called value-added services). The operating activities in Poland and Ukraine will be described below.

Activities in Poland

Grupa Pracuj generates most of its revenues on the Polish market. According to the data reported by the company, Grupa Pracuj generated approximately PLN 2020 million in 265, i.e. 88,5% of the group's revenues. The company's offer on the Polish market includes:

  • A recruitment website under the brand of pracuj.pl along with specialized industry sectors, e.g. it.pracuj.pl.
  • Additional services such as: "Work zone", virtual job fair, "Recruitment 360".
  • ATS platform sold on the basis of SaaS called eRecruiter.
  • Additional recruitment websites: Dryg.pl, theprotocol.it.

Pracuj.pl website

The Pracuj.pl website is the largest recruitment portal in Poland. The website focuses mainly on office job offers (the so-called white collar segment). According to the Gemius research, the website is used by 3,1 million users per month. 35 clients were served through Pracuj.pl and over 000 recruitment projects were implemented.

Services for employees

Pracuj.pl focuses on facilitating the "candidate path" from the moment of looking for a job to being invited to an interview. Through the website, users can apply for job positions without sending a CV (through their profile) or checking the status of their application. Thanks to this, the so-called user experiencewhich makes it very easy for users to use the portal. Thanks to this, many employees start looking for a job on the website pracuj.pl. Along with the changes in the behavior of users on the Internet, a mobile application and a mobile version of the website were introduced. At the same time, users can use additional functions, such as payroll reports, salary calculators, tips or a CV creator.

Services for employers

It is the main source of the company's income. Employers pay for placing job advertisements on the Pracuj.pl website. Companies can post a job advertisement for a period of 30 days. While the job advertisement is up-to-date, companies can purchase additional services to increase the attractiveness of the advertisement. These include:

    • Refreshment,
    • Distinction with a logo,
    • Great offer,
    • Positioning.

Refreshing - this is a feature that allows you to update the date of a job posting. As a result, the ad is placed higher in the search results. 

Distinction with a logo - allows you to distinguish a job advertisement with the company's logo.

Super offer - allows you to distinguish a job offer with a special designation "Super Offer".

Positioning - this functionality was introduced in the first quarter of 2021. This allows you to show job advertisements more often in the search results. 

Another offer of Grupa Pracuj for employers is job fairs JOBICON. It is a one-stop-shop event where the employer can present his brand and job offers to his candidates. At the same time, video chats, workshops, webinars and meetings with celebrities are organized at JOBICON. Job fairs are held twice a year (in spring and autumn).

Employers can also post theirs (for a fee) business profiles on the Pracuj.pl website. The employer's profile includes a description of the activity, current job offers, a description of the recruitment process and contact details.

A very important solution offered by Grupa Pracuj in Poland is the eRecruiter platform. The aforementioned platform is offered in the SaaS model. eRecruiter generated PLN 25,3 million in Poland, which represented 8% of the company's revenues. According to the data prepared by the company, about 75% of all recruitment is supported by eRecruiter. Thanks to the platform's functionality, candidates can safely apply via application forms. On the other hand, eRecruiter provides employers with the possibility of preliminary, automatic selection of candidates (e.g. they reject candidates who expect too much salary). Employers can also easily organize, filter and edit the candidate database. What's more, eRecruiter allows employers to verify where the candidates' CVs are coming from. As a result, employers know which channels are most effective in "Attracting potential candidates".

Activities in Ukraine

The main activity of the company in Ukraine is carried out under the brand name robota.ua. Grupa Pracuj acquired the rights to the Ukrainian recruitment website in 2006. It can be said that robota.ua is the equivalent of the Polish pracuj.pl. According to the data presented by the company, approximately 75,1% of revenues come from fees for placing job offers on the website received from enterprises and recruitment agencies. The remaining revenues were generated from providing enterprises with databases containing candidates' CVs and from additional services (image building, internet advertising).

The website has about 150 employees who try to offer services to enterprises (direct and telesales). The most important clients are large enterprises, which owned 55% of job offers published on the Ukrainian platform in 2020. At the same time, large enterprises generated about 70% of robota.ua revenues. According to Grupa Pracuj data, rabota.ua had 2021 active customers (enterprises and recruitment agencies) by the end of Q63 XNUMX. 

As in the case of pracuj.pl, the Ukrainian website has a flywheel effect. The more job offers, the more active users. The influx of new users increases the chances of companies finding a competent employee. As a result, it encourages new companies (Small and Medium) to look for employees online. According to the company's data, in 2020 the robota.ua website had an average of 3,7 million unique users per month. It is worth mentioning that 9 years earlier, the number of unique CVs was only 0,47 million. 

The activity of Pracuj Ventures

Grupa Pracuj is a limited partner of the alternative investment company (ASI) - Pracuj Ventures. The managers of this fund who manage the important positions are Pawel Leks (one of the co-founders of Grupa Pracuj), Maciej Noga (co-founder of Pracuj) and Mykola Mykhailov. This is important because the management board of Grupa Pracuj cannot directly influence the investment policy of ASI. 

Grupa Pracuj does not have its direct representative in the key management personnel of Pracuj Ventures. The investment decisions are made by the members of the investment committee. It is worth mentioning that important operational activities in Pracuj Ventures are performed by Przemysław Gacek, who acts as an ASI investor, and not because he is the President of the Management Board of Grupa Pracuj.

Pracuj Ventures invests in start-ups from the technology industry, which operate in the HR (Human Resources), education and development sectors. These start-ups often act as HR Tech companies. They can be, among others. human capital management (HCM) systems, automation of HR processes (e.g. chatbots). Other examples are, for example, suppliers of tools for managing employee education, benefit platforms or software for analyzing and planning talent development.

As a rule, the fund supports promising companies with amounts ranging from PLN 0,5 million to PLN 2 million. Most often, the activities of start-ups are complementary to the Group's solutions. Pracuj sometimes takes over a promising company. In the years 2019-2021, the fund analyzed a total of 410 potential investments and invested in 7 companies. Ultimately, Pracuj Ventures plans to involve funds in 9-11 start-ups.

Currently, the portfolio of Pracuj Ventures includes:

  • Wandlee - automation of sales, marketing, recruitment, customer service using a virtual assistant such as chatbot,
  • Worksmile - a wellbeing platform that combines benefits for employees with elements of wellbeing,
  • Inhire.io - a recruitment platform that focuses on the IT market,
  • Gymsteer - a platform for managing fitness clubs,
  • Gamfi - tools offering motivation for employees (e.g. gamification),
  • Sherlock Waste - a platform thanks to which employees can report problems in the workplace,
  • Kadromierz - a tool for creating online work schedules.

customers 

Throughout the period of Grupa Pracuj's operation, the main goal was to acquire large and medium-sized domestic (Polish, Ukrainian) and international companies. Another important source of clients are recruitment agencies, which still see an opportunity to publish job offers on the pracuj.pl and robota.ua websites. The company is currently trying to penetrate the SME market (small and medium-sized enterprises). Currently, Grupa Pracuj is also trying to increase the activity among micro-enterprises (employing less than 10 employees). It is worth mentioning that the company's revenues are very diversified. According to the prospectus, no client generated more than 1% of revenues.

Sales and marketing

The company spends its sales and marketing resources on increasing brand recognition among both employees and employers. Although a lot of traffic to Grupa Pracuj websites is organic, the company still tries to spend marketing measures to increase traffic to the group's platforms. One of the tools is, for example, real time bidding (automatic buying of advertising space on the Internet, e.g. on websites). In addition to buying advertising banners on the internet, portals pracuj.pl and robot.ua they run advertising campaigns in traditional media or prepare guides, educational content or podcasts. 

In the case of employers, marketing activities are used to build a brand with clients "Expert on the recruitment market". Grupa Pracuj develops educational projects such as "HR Challenges" or "Academy of Inspirations". The company is also developing a content marketing offer to raise awareness in the HR departments of companies. 

Company dividend policy

The company's activity is very profitable. This is due to the fact that the company has gained such a scale of activity that it does not have to compete for orders from clients (entrepreneurs) with the price. Grupa Pracuj pays a significant part of its profits to investors in the form of dividends. In 2018, the company generated PLN 117,7 million of net profit and allocated PLN 2019 million to dividends in 47,9. A year later, Grupa Pracuj paid out PLN 61,8 million as dividends. 

On June 28, 2021, the General Meeting of Shareholders decided to allocate the entire net profit for 2020 (PLN 72,2 million) as a dividend. In addition, it was decided that another PLN 38 million would be paid from the reserve capital (profits from previous years). In 2021, Grupa Pracuj will pay out PLN 103,7 million in the form of dividends. As at the prospectus date, PLN 79,8 million has already been paid out.

In the prospectus, the company announced that in the medium term it intends to pay out no less than 50% of the net profit for the financial year. The company, however, stipulates that if the current investment needs are greater, the dividend may be temporarily reduced. 

Risk factors

It is worth remembering that the Polish recruitment market is very competitive. Market entry barriers are very low. There are many recruitment portals that try to "chew on" the position of pracuj.pl. Among the competitors can be given OLX, Infopraca, Praca.pl, Just Join IT. In addition, social networking sites such as LinkedIn and Facebook are also a threat. One of the moats owned by Grupa Pracuj is very high recognition, which means that a large part of the traffic to the websites is obtained organic. In order not to lose its position, Pracuj devotes large marketing resources to maintaining brand recognition.

Another risk factor is the deterioration of the macroeconomic situation in Poland and Ukraine. If GDP falls, the situation in the labor market becomes more difficult as companies limit new recruitments. The more difficult the situation on the labor market, the fewer new job offers there are. This results in a decrease in revenues generated from the publication of new job offers and additional services.

The financial data 

Grupa Pracuj has a very profitable business. Additionally, the company does not have to incur large capital expenditures (CAPEX). High profitability and prudent financial policy meant that the company is not indebted. It is worth noting that as the scale of operations increases, the operating margin increases. As a result, you can see the operating leverage in this business model. Below is a summary of the financial results of Pracuj:

PLN million 2018 2019 2020 9M 2020 9M 2021
revenues 327,2 367,5 299,3 214,7 343,8
Operational profit 127,1 159,9 136,1 98,3 175,8
Operating margin + 38,8 % + 43,5 % + 45,5 % + 45,8 % 51,1%
Net profit 117,7 128,4 106,9 75,1 212,6

Source: own study based on data from the prospectus

The reason for the increase in revenues was the rebuilding of labor demand after the slowdown resulting from COVID-19. 

Grupa Pracuj is a cash machine. High operating cash flow and low CAPEX resulted in high free cash flow (FCF). In the years 2018-2021, the company repaid almost PLN 180 million. As a result, the company currently has no interest debt.

PLN million 2018 2019 2020 9M 2020 9M 2021
Net profit 117,7 128,4 106,9 75,1 212,6
OCF * 149,2 151,0 124,5 82,0 153,5
CAPEX ** 6,3 7,2 2,3 1,9 5,9
FCF *** 142,9 143,8 122,2 80,1 147,6
Dividend 1,2 47,9 61,8 61,8 82,9
Loan repayment 70,0 80,0 0 0 29,2

* operating cash flow, ** capital expenditure, *** free cash flow

Source: own study based on data from the prospectus

Competition and comparison companies

The company does not operate in a vacuum. It has a lot of competition both on the Polish and Ukrainian market. Some competitors have little potential to put pressure on Grupa Pracuj. However, there is potential competition, which includes OLX (belongs to Prosus listed in Amsterdam), Facebook (potential competitor), LinkedIn (Microsoft). Indirect potential competition are also GigEconomy-related platforms, such as Upwork and Fiverr. 

It is also worth noting that there is a recruitment platform listed on the stock exchange operating on the Russian market and the former USSR countries. It is a Headhunter company. Companies operating on the American and Japanese Recruit Holdings or Chinese 51Jobs.com are also listed on global stock exchanges. 

Headhunter

It is the largest recruitment platform in Russia. The company is also a leader in such markets as Kazakhstan, Belarus and Uzbekistan. Headhunter also operates on the Azerbaijani and Kyrgyz markets. Previously, the company also operated in Ukraine, but it withdrew from this market due to the political conflict between Russia and Ukraine. According to data prepared by SimilarWeb, it is the fourth most popular website related to the labor market (indeed, jooble, glassdoor).

million RUB 2017 2018 2019 2020
revenues 4 734 6 118 7 789 8 282
Operational profit 1 385 2 099 2 805 2 840
Operating margin 29,3% 34,3% 36,0% 34,3%
Net profit 401,5 949,3 1 448 1 749

Source: own study

Recruit Holdings

It is a company listed in Japan. About half of the revenues come from the Japanese market, another important market is the United States, which accounts for 21% of revenues. The company operates in many markets. It owns websites such as Indeed (bought in 2012), which is a recruiting platform, and Glassdoor (bought in 2018). Glassdoor is a website where current and former employees share their insights on the organizational culture or the recruitment process. In addition, Recruit has many different websites, such as Zexy (wedding segment), Study Sapuri (educational platform), Hot Pepper Gourmet (food segment). The company employs approximately 47 people.

51 Jobs 

It is a Chinese company that was founded in 1998. In 2020, 58% of the company's revenues were generated from recruitment platforms, while the remaining part was generated from other services for HR departments. The company made its debut on the Nasdaq in 2004. The collected funds allowed to increase the scale of the business. In 2016, the number of registered customers exceeded 100 million. In 2020, the number of registered users exceeded 171 million. The company's flagship service is 51job.com, one of the most popular recruitment platforms in China. In addition, the company also has a website lagou.com, which specializes in recruiting employees for the IT industry.

OLX

It is one of the largest companies in the world operating in the classifieds model. The main source of income is the OLX platform, where there are local offers for sale of things and job offers. In addition, the OLX group also includes sites such as Avito, AutoTrader, Otodom, Otomoto, 321Sold! or Autovit.ro. In 2019, OLX's revenues amounted to € 1,3 billion. Currently, OLX is part of the Prosus group.

Summation

The company is currently valued at approximately PLN 5,5 billion. Grupa Pracuj is a leader on the Polish market and has a leading position on the Ukrainian market. The company has a very profitable business. Grupa Pracuj in recent years has generated an operating margin of 40% -50% and generates very high free cash flow. The company has no debt and has announced that it intends to pay dividends on a regular basis.

Competition in the market is fierce and entry barriers are very low. Pracuj.pl was one of the pioneers on the market of recruitment platforms, which allowed him to have a better starting position. But it is thanks to operational efficiency that Grupa Pracuj owes its first place on the market. Thanks to this, the flywheel began to work. The more users visiting the website in search of work, the easier it was to attract paying customers (large and medium-sized enterprises). The more jobs there are, the more new users will appear who want to find a job. So far, the company is not strongly present on the CEE market. This is necessary because the chances of dynamic growth on the Polish and Ukrainian markets are limited.
